What is a CryptoRobotics trading bot?

A CryptoRobotics trading bot is a ready-made strategy card you can add to your account from the Bots section. Each card shows a name, pair focus (for example BTC/USDT or ALT routes), a recent average monthly profit metric, an Exchanges tooltip with supported venues, and a payment model (monthly subscription or a profit-sharing label such as 15% FROM PROFIT). From the card, you can Test, Subscribe, Connect, Go to my bots, or Add one more bot. In other words, a crypto bot trading setup here is a curated list of strategies you can enable with a couple of clicks.

How CryptoRobotics bot trading works (from the UI)

  1. Open “Bots”. You’ll see categories (Partner bots, Futures bots, Spot bots, PSH bots) with performance charts on each card.
  2. Pick a card. Every trading crypto bot shows its supported venues via the Exchanges badge.
  3. Choose the action:
    • Test – where available, simulates behavior (often shown on PSH or subscription bots).
    • Subscribe – used for fixed fees (e.g., $25, $39, $200, or $20 depending on the card).
    • Connect – used for profit-sharing bots (labels like 15% FROM PROFIT, 18% FROM PROFIT, 20% FROM PROFIT, 30% FROM PROFIT appear on cards).
    • Go to my bots / Add one more bot – manage or duplicate instances.
  4. Run and monitor. Cards show time-series charts so you can visually track how a best trading bot for crypto has been performing lately.

This flow is visible across the catalog, so whichever best crypto bot trading option you choose, the steps feel consistent.

Pros & cons (overall)

Pros

  • Wide exchange coverage. Many best bot crypto trading cards support 10–15+ venues, including Binance, Binance.US, Bitfinex, Bitget, Bybit UTA (Spot/Futures), Gateio, HTX, Kraken, KuCoin, MEXC, OKX, XT, plus Demo Spot/Demo Futures.
  • Two clear payment paths. Fixed monthly pricing ($20–$200) or profit sharing (15–30% FROM PROFIT) shown right on each card—great for both value seekers and those prioritizing alignment with results.
  • One-click actions. Consistent Test / Subscribe / Connect / Go to my bots buttons make it easy to try a best trading bot for crypto and scale it.
  • Visual performance. Each card includes a time-series chart so you can quickly compare best trading bot crypto behavior.

Cons

  • Performance varies. Some cards show negative or low recent monthly results (e.g., Sigma Bot –20.53%, Mono Optimus (ALT) –0.51%). A trading bot crypto is still market-dependent.
  • Different fees by tool. Subscription levels range widely (from $20 to $200), and profit-sharing rates differ (15%/16%/18%/20%/30%), so budgeting requires attention.
  • Venue-specific availability. Certain futures bots only connect to Binance Futures, Bitget Futures, and Bybit UTA Futures—if your exchange isn’t listed, pick another best crypto bot trading card.
